Presenting language proficiency on a resume requires a structured strategy. This entails specifying the language, adopted by an evaluation of proficiency degree. For instance, one would possibly listing “Spanish: Skilled Working Proficiency” or “German: Conversational.” Completely different scales can be utilized to indicate proficiency, akin to elementary, intermediate, superior, fluent, native, or skilled working proficiency. It is also useful to offer context for the abilities, akin to “French: Intermediate (learn, write, communicate) – Utilized throughout a semester overseas in Paris.”

Language Identification
Exact identification of every language is paramount. Ambiguity can come up from dialects and regional variations. As an example, merely stating “Chinese language” lacks specificity. As an alternative, specifying “Mandarin Chinese language” or “Cantonese” supplies readability. Correct identification ensures that employers perceive the particular communication abilities supplied.
-
Proficiency Ranges
A self-assessment of proficiency for every language is crucial. Using standardized scales, such because the Interagency Language Roundtable (ILR) scale or the Widespread European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R), permits for constant and goal analysis. These scales present a framework for understanding nuanced variations between ranges like “fundamental,” “conversational,” “fluent,” and “native.” For instance, indicating “Spanish: CEFR B2” presents a extra exact understanding than “Spanish: Conversational.”

A number of standardized scales supply frameworks for describing proficiency. The Interagency Language Roundtable (ILR) scale, incessantly utilized by authorities businesses, supplies granular ranges starting from 0 (No Proficiency) to five (Native or Bilingual Proficiency). The Widespread European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R) presents one other well known scale, utilizing a six-level system (A1, A2, B1, B2, C1, C2) to categorize proficiency. Using these established scales provides objectivity and permits for simpler comparability throughout candidates. As an alternative of counting on subjective phrases like “conversational” or “superior,” utilizing a standardized scale, akin to “Spanish: CEFR B1,” supplies a clearer, extra universally understood benchmark. Offering context alongside the proficiency degree additional enhances understanding, for instance, “German: ILR Stage 3 – Interpreted throughout worldwide conferences.”

-
Interagency Language Roundtable (ILR) Scale
The ILR scale, developed by the U.S. Overseas Service Institute, presents an in depth five-level framework for assessing proficiency in talking and studying. Starting from 0 (No Proficiency) to five (Functionally Native Proficiency), every degree outlines particular capabilities associated to comprehension, fluency, vocabulary, and communication duties. Utilizing the ILR scale permits people to pinpoint their skills with precision. For instance, an ILR Stage 3 signifies skilled working proficiency, appropriate for conducting conferences and negotiations. This specificity eliminates ambiguity and ensures acceptable talent matching.
-
Widespread European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R)
The CEFR supplies a well known six-level framework (A1, A2, B1, B2, C1, C2) for assessing language proficiency throughout varied abilities, together with listening, studying, talking, and writing. This framework is broadly utilized in Europe and past, providing a standardized benchmark for language learners and employers alike. Indicating a CEFR degree, akin to B2 ( Vantage or Higher Intermediate), signifies the power to know advanced texts and work together with native audio system with a level of fluency. This standardized illustration simplifies cross-border comparisons and promotes readability in worldwide contexts.
-
Selecting the Acceptable Scale
Deciding on probably the most acceptable scale is determined by context and viewers. The ILR scale is usually most popular in authorities and diplomatic settings, whereas the CEFR is extra widespread in instructional and enterprise contexts. Understanding the target market’s familiarity with totally different scales ensures efficient communication. Whatever the chosen scale, consistency in utility all through the resume is essential. Mixing scales can create confusion; adhering to at least one framework supplies a coherent illustration of language skills.

Steadily Requested Questions
This part addresses widespread queries relating to the inclusion of language abilities on a resume. Clear and correct illustration of language proficiency is essential for each candidates and employers, and these FAQs intention to make clear greatest practices.
Query 1: Ought to all identified languages be listed on a resume?
Whereas complete illustration of abilities is usually advisable, prioritizing languages related to the goal place is really helpful. Itemizing languages unrelated to job necessities can dilute the influence of extra pertinent abilities.
Query 2: How ought to language proficiency be described if a standardized scale is not used?
If a standardized scale is not used, descriptive phrases akin to “Primary,” “Intermediate,” “Superior,” or “Fluent” might be employed. Nonetheless, offering context by way of particular examples is essential for clarifying sensible utility.
Query 3: The place ought to the “Languages” part be positioned on a resume?
Placement is determined by relevance to the goal position. If language proficiency is a major requirement, placement close to the highest is really helpful. If much less essential, placement inside a devoted “Expertise” part is acceptable.
Query 4: How can one substantiate claims of language proficiency?
Contextual examples demonstrating sensible utility, akin to “Interpreted throughout worldwide conferences,” present concrete proof of language abilities. Standardized check scores or certifications may also add credibility.
Query 5: Is it essential to specify proficiency in all 4 language abilities (studying, writing, talking, listening)?
Specificity enhances readability. If proficiency ranges range throughout totally different abilities, indicating these variations (e.g., “Spanish: Studying – Superior, Talking – Intermediate”) supplies a extra correct illustration.
Query 6: How ought to dialects be dealt with on a resume?
Specificity is essential. As an alternative of merely itemizing “Arabic,” specifying the dialect (e.g., “Levantine Arabic” or “Egyptian Arabic”) supplies a extra exact understanding of communication capabilities.

Ideas for Itemizing Languages on a Resume
This part presents sensible steering on successfully presenting language abilities to maximise influence on potential employers. Every tip supplies particular suggestions and examples to make sure readability, accuracy, and relevance.
Tip 1: Be Particular: Keep away from obscure phrases like “conversational.” Make the most of standardized scales just like the ILR or CEFR, or present clear descriptions akin to “Skilled Working Proficiency” supported by contextual examples.
Tip 2: Context Issues: Reveal sensible utility. “French: Fluent – Negotiated contracts with French-speaking purchasers” is extra impactful than merely “French: Fluent.”
Tip 3: Prioritize Relevance: Listing languages related to the goal place. If a job does not require Italian, itemizing it would detract from extra pertinent abilities.
Tip 4: Preserve Consistency: Use a uniform proficiency scale and formatting all through the “Languages” part. Consistency enhances readability and professionalism.
Tip 5: Accuracy is Paramount: Overstating proficiency can result in mismatches and hinder profession development. Trustworthy and correct self-assessment is essential.
Tip 6: Tailor to the Function: Adapt language presentation to every particular job utility. Spotlight probably the most related abilities primarily based on the job description’s necessities.
Tip 7: Proofread Rigorously: Errors within the “Languages” part, particularly spelling or grammatical errors associated to the languages themselves, can create a adverse impression. Thorough proofreading is crucial.
